- Compound InfoObject '&1' not found for InfoObject '&2'. ?The SAP error message
RS_B4H_TRANSFER_APD103
indicates that there is a problem with the transfer of data related to a compound InfoObject in SAP BW (Business Warehouse). Specifically, the error message states that a certain compound InfoObject (denoted as&1
) cannot be found for another InfoObject (denoted as&2
).Cause:
- Missing Compound InfoObject: The compound InfoObject that is being referenced does not exist in the system. This could be due to it not being created, deleted, or not activated.
- Incorrect Configuration: There may be a misconfiguration in the InfoObject settings or in the data transfer process.
- Transport Issues: If the InfoObjects were transported from one system to another (e.g., from development to production), there may have been issues during the transport process that caused the compound InfoObject to not be available.
- Data Source Issues: The data source from which the data is being transferred may not be correctly set up or may not include the necessary InfoObjects.
Solution:
- Check Existence of InfoObjects: Verify that both the compound InfoObject (
&1
) and the base InfoObject (&2
) exist in the system. You can do this by navigating to the InfoObject maintenance transaction (e.g., RSA1) and checking the InfoObjects.- Activate InfoObjects: If the InfoObjects exist but are not activated, activate them. This can be done in the InfoObject maintenance screen.
- Review Data Transfer Process: Check the data transfer process to ensure that it is correctly configured and that all necessary InfoObjects are included.
- Check Transport Logs: If the InfoObjects were recently transported, check the transport logs for any errors or warnings that may indicate issues during the transport.
- Recreate Missing InfoObjects: If the compound InfoObject is missing and cannot be found, you may need to recreate it based on the specifications or requirements.
- Consult Documentation: Review any relevant documentation or notes related to the specific InfoObjects and their configurations.
